Abstract

A storm drain filter system (10, 100) includes a closure (31, 131) for selectively closing a filter (26, 122) when the latter is filled with sediments (13) or when water flow (11) into the storm drain filter system (10, 100) exceeds a filtering capacity of the filter (26, 122). When the filter (26, 122) is closed, water (11) incoming at the storm drain filter system (10, 100) is diverted to a portion thereof allowing water (11) to enter a storm drain (12) without filtration. In some embodiments, any sediments (13) already collected in the filter (26, 122) are prevented from exiting the filter (26, 122) when the filter (26, 122) is closed.

         23 . A method of filtering sediment-laden water in a storm drain, the method comprising:
 (a) filtering at least part of the water incoming at the storm drain using a filter and collecting at least part of the sediments in the filter, the filter occupying only part of the storm drain so that the storm drain includes an unobstructed portion unobstructed by the filter;   (b) once a maximal filtering capacity of the filter has been reached, closing access to the filter and redirecting substantially all the water incoming at the storm drain to the unobstructed portion.   
     
     
         24 . The method as defined in  claim 23 , wherein the maximal filtering capacity is reached when the filter is filled with the sediments. 
     
     
         25 . The method as defined in  claim 23 , wherein the maximal filtering capacity is reached when the water flows into the filter at a rate large enough that water accumulates in the filter and fills the latter. 
     
     
         26 . The method as defined in  claim 23 , wherein, at step (b), the sediments already accumulated in the filter are substantially prevented from exiting the filter while the water is redirected. 
     
     
         27 . The method as defined in  claim 23 , further comprising (c) emptying the filter after step (b), reopening the filter to allow access thereto, and resuming the method at step (a).
